Bethany Volunteer Firemen's Auxiliary presents it's annual Pancake Bunny Breakfast


This family fun event will take place on Sunday March 10th from 8:00 a.m.-11:30 a.m. at BVFD headquarters, 765 Amity Road Bethany. 


The cost for the breakfast is $10 for adults, $5 for children, children under 3 are free.  Breakfast includes pancakes, eggs, bacon, sausage, coffee, tea and juice.  One photograph with the Easter Bunny is included per family!


Tickets will be available at the door the day of the event.  If you have any questions please contact 203-410-2602.
